Skip to content

Commit 1d6aaa0

Browse files
authored
Merge pull request #577 from kubero-dev/template/speedtest-tracker
Template / Add Speedtest Tracker
2 parents 15f6f21 + f7c0c43 commit 1d6aaa0

File tree

1 file changed

+63
-0
lines changed

1 file changed

+63
-0
lines changed
Lines changed: 63 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,63 @@
1+
apiVersion: application.kubero.dev/v1alpha1
2+
kind: KuberoApp
3+
metadata:
4+
name: speedtest-tracker
5+
annotations:
6+
kubero.dev/template.architecture: '["linux/amd64", "linux/arm64"]'
7+
kubero.dev/template.description: "Speedtest Tracker is a self-hosted application that monitors the performance and uptime of your internet connection."
8+
kubero.dev/template.icon: "https://raw.githubusercontent.com/linuxserver/docker-templates/master/linuxserver.io/img/speedtest-tracker-logo.png"
9+
kubero.dev/template.installation: "Generate an APP_KEY and set the APP_URL environment variable
10+
to the domain you will be hosting the application on.
11+
Use this site to generate the App Key : https://generate-random.org/laravel-key-generator?count=1"
12+
kubero.dev/template.links: '["https://docs.speedtest-tracker.dev/"]'
13+
kubero.dev/template.screenshots: "[]"
14+
kubero.dev/template.source: "https://github.com/alexjustesen/speedtest-tracker"
15+
kubero.dev/template.categories: '["monitoring", "utilities"]'
16+
kubero.dev/template.title: "Speedtest Tracker"
17+
kubero.dev/template.website: "https://speedtest-tracker.dev/"
18+
labels:
19+
manager: kubero
20+
spec:
21+
name: speedtest-tracker
22+
deploymentstrategy: docker
23+
envVars:
24+
- name: APP_KEY
25+
value: base64:dmhkaGltaGF0NXdpcmIyeDU2Y3RxNzRzbXZqZzBuamw=
26+
- name: DB_CONNECTION
27+
value: sqlite
28+
- name: APP_URL
29+
value: https://speedtest-tracker.localhost
30+
- name: APP_NAME
31+
value: Speedtest Tracker
32+
- name: APP_TIMEZONE
33+
value: UTC
34+
- name: APP_LOCALE
35+
value: en
36+
- name: APP_FALLBACK_LOCALE
37+
value: en
38+
- name: BCRYPT_ROUNDS
39+
value: "12"
40+
- name: APP_FAKER_LOCALE
41+
value: en_US
42+
- name: PRUNE_RESULTS_OLDER_THAN
43+
value: "0"
44+
extraVolumes:
45+
- accessMode: ReadWriteOnce
46+
accessModes:
47+
- ReadWriteOnce
48+
emptyDir: false
49+
mountPath: /config
50+
name: speedtest-tracker-volume
51+
size: 1Gi
52+
storageClass: standard
53+
cronjobs: []
54+
addons: []
55+
web:
56+
replicaCount: 1
57+
worker:
58+
replicaCount: 0
59+
image:
60+
containerPort: "80"
61+
pullPolicy: Always
62+
repository: lscr.io/linuxserver/speedtest-tracker
63+
tag: latest

0 commit comments

Comments
 (0)